The body can be full of vitality relying on oxygen. Inhalation of oxygen, use it to burn fuel (consumption of food) and energy production. However, cells use oxygen to produce by-product of high-energy form of oxygen molecules waste. These reactive oxygen molecules have a name, called free radicals. Free radicals are harmful to human tissue and cell structure. This damage is known as oxidative stress. The body use glutathione oxygen to impose its own pressure. Most age-related health problems, such as wrinkles, heart disease and Alzheimer's disease are associated with oxidative stress too much about.
